3. License Suspension

In Illinois, you can’t lose your license for not paying fines, and most moving violations don’t involve a prosecutor. If a prosecutor is involved, we should talk to a defense attorney about the situation. They can also expedite the court process, allowing you to regain your license sooner.

4. Insurance Increase

Speeding tickets can cost a lot of money. But the long-term effects on insurance costs are much worse. If you have a traffic ticket on your record, your car insurance rates could go through the roof. It will cost you hundreds or even thousands of dollars more per year. A lawyer can help you lower these costs.

How Do You Get A Speeding Ticket Dismissed In Illinois?

Only criminal charges, not traffic tickets, are eligible for expungement under Illinois law. As a result, the only way to clear a traffic ticket conviction from your driving record is to re-arrest the case.

How Can I Get My Illinois Speeding Ticket Reduced?

If you are found guilty of the traffic violation, you may request a mitigation hearing to have your fine reduced.
